Abstract

A system related to automated testing gap categorization and codebase vulnerability localization in large-scale distributed computing environments. The system may receive an incident record containing unstructured text and identifiers pointing to external systems, obtain content from the external systems based on the identifiers, and aggregate the content into a unified context payload. The system may generate a fingerprint data structure based on the unified context payload and a versioned analysis prompt to determine whether AI model analysis is needed. The system may perform multi-stage AI analysis including identifying where a supervised analysis system indicated a testing gap, classifying the type of testing gap using a hierarchical taxonomy, and using timestamps to isolate one or more code commits that caused the incident. The system may verify the existence of the code commits and generate a visualization of the testing gap.
